[QUOTE="Ron Kimball, post: 60383, member: 405"] Re: Has anybody layed hands on the mackie DL1608 yet? It looks ideal for those of us doing private parties where we often get stuck mixing side-stage :( . I certainly wouldn't mind retiring my snake even when it can be used - it's often a tripping hazard even though I carry a few sections of cable ramp. It will also save ~20 minutes of "snake wrangling" time and pack space. My RCF 310A's over TH-Mini's rig fits in my hatchback car but it sure is a tight fit to get everything in there including the 8 monitors I carry LOL. [/QUOTE]
